No anyone can take it from the store. It's not very regulated, so similar to say St Johns Wort, you never truly know how much you are getting. And much controversy has happened when different testing agencies pulled DHEA off the shelves and tested their amounts of DHEA compared to their label amounts, and some were found to literally be sugar pills

Egg quality and numbers start to drop at 35, and if every single woman in the world was tested starting at age 25 through their 35th birthday for FSH and AMH, you'd start to see that some have egg quality dropping earlier for some women, like at age 31. We just usually don't test everyone. I think it also means your progress towards losing eggs should be slower, since it looks like a normal aging process and not some weird anomaly
